Enlit Europe 2025 concluded with resounding success, gathering more than 15,000 energy professionals, 700+ exhibitors, and 500+ speakers at the Bilbao Exhibition Centre from 18–20 November 2025. As one of the sector’s most influential annual events, ENLIT once again proved to be a powerhouse of innovation, debate, collaboration, and forward-looking energy solutions.
A Strong Collective Presence: “Flexible Solutions Empowering Citizens” Booth
At the joint booth shared with ASCEND, BEST-Storage, BuildON, ECHO, FEDECOM, HYSTORE, InterPED, NEUTRALPATH, oPEN Lab, and ThumbsUp, HARMONISE showcased how digitally enabled energy optimisation and district-level orchestration can empower cities and citizens on the path to climate neutrality.
Key features of the booth included:
- Interoperable digital tools for energy optimisation
- Hands-on demonstrations of flexibility and storage solutions
- Retrofitting and governance frameworks for PED replication
- Citizen engagement approaches to accelerate local action
- A collective Innovation Map, where all eleven projects displayed their pilot sites — illustrating the growing ecosystem of real-world PED, energy-flexibility, and climate-neutrality demonstrations across Europe.
The booth became a lively meeting point for policymakers, utilities, researchers, and municipalities eager to understand how citizen-centred solutions can scale across diverse urban contexts.
Dr. Christos Korkas Showcases HARMONISE Vision on the Main Stage
Representing the HARMONISE consortium, Dr. Christos Korkas (CERTH) joined the panel “Energy Communities & Positive Energy Districts”, offering an insightful presentation on:
Optimised Energy Management for Positive Energy Districts (PEDs)
Based on his ENLIT presentation, Dr. Korkas highlighted:
- What makes a PED net-positive
- How smart coordination of buildings, renewable generation, storage, and EV charging can improve renewable self-use by 20–40%
- Why interoperability, forecasting accuracy, and scalable control systems are essential to coordinate complex district-level environments
- The transitions from building-focused optimisation to autonomous, district-level orchestration
- Future-ready trends: PED clusters, vehicle-to-grid integration, and AI-driven decision support for operators and citizens
During the roundtable, Korkas emphasised that “reliable real-time energy management demands interoperable systems above all else”, a message that strongly resonated with challenges faced across the EU PED landscape.
